Transaction e63df51b73c32b869a4628fcbb19db745fa9257ae109cd8e2f4c8dff86d667be

1 Input
2 Outputs
  • e63df51b73c32b869a4628fcbb19db745fa9257ae109cd8e2f4c8dff86d667be:0
  • value  1066
    address  1MbkzHfDgsLTwrZWMypD8VkfAKdemvGfbP
  • e63df51b73c32b869a4628fcbb19db745fa9257ae109cd8e2f4c8dff86d667be:1
  • value  51401
    address  3FuuhztS8dW4f1V3ra5AXFAzErQUuNGyoq